About the Role




Quest Global is seeking an experienced HSE & Production Standards Lead to take a hands-on role driving Health, Safety & Environmental performance, raising operational standards, and ensuring audit findings are effectively implemented across production and overhaul operations. This role is central to supporting the site leadership team through a period of operational improvement and transformation.

Key Responsibilities



Lead HSE Standards: Champion and reinforce cusotmer HSE standards across rail production and overhaul activities. Act as the key point of contact for site safety, ensuring proactive identification and resolution of issues. Drive delivery of safety improvement actions, including training, onboarding processes, and safety topic enhancements. Operational Excellence & Audit Implementation: Translate internal and external audit findings into clear action plans, ensuring timely and effective resolution. Support cultural and leadership initiatives to embed high safety and production standards. Coordinate and track actions across leadership, production teams, and logistics to ensure progress and accountability. Action Plan Delivery - based on the current production improvement action plan, typical workstreams include: Production facility presence to drive standards. Implement findings of recent working at height and noise audits. Implement safety improvements highlighted from the continuous improvement plan. Supporting leadership commitment to daily shop-floor engagement and production stand-ups. Enhancing training and onboarding, including supporting the development of safety training roadmaps Stakeholder Engagement: Work closely with site leadership and functions including logistics, training, and CI.

Provide clear updates on progress, blockers, and next steps to leadership forums.

Work Experience



Skills & Experience



Proven experience leading HSE and operational improvement in a rail, heavy engineering, or complex manufacturing environment. Strong understanding of production operations, overhaul processes, and safety management systems. Demonstrated ability to turn audit findings into action, with a focus on sustainable change. Excellent stakeholder engagement and influencing skills at all levels. Structured and disciplined approach to action tracking and follow-through. * NEBOSH or equivalent HSE qualification preferred.
